Job Opportunity: Deputy Head Teacher at Witherslack Group

Salary: £71,614 - £78,000 + excellent benefits

About the Role

Our Deputy Head Teachers are inspired by making small yet impactful changes in the lives of young people. We celebrate these 'huge small victories' — moments that may seem minor but collectively create a significant difference.

Responsibilities
  1. Work alongside the Head Teacher to set the vision for the school’s future.
  2. Ensure the right staffing and plans are in place to support our pupils’ development.
  3. Support children and young people with Autism Spectrum Disorder, Social, Emotional and Mental Health needs.
  4. Lead and motivate staff, fostering a positive and resilient environment.
  5. Contribute to creating a nurturing, well-resourced school environment.
About Bramley Hill School

Based in Surrey, Bramley Hill School is an independent specialist day school, rated 'Good' by Ofsted, catering to pupils with autism and related needs.
